我们应该如何在远程IoT Edge部署上管理Moby / Docker映像?

时间:2019-06-19 18:25:45

标签: azure azure-iot-edge moby

从部署在许多运行Moby的设备上的Azure IoT Edge中删除未使用的图像的推荐方法是什么?

如果我在Docker上,我将使用以下命令:

docker rmi imageName

这似乎在Moby上不存在。另外,建议在运行IoT Edge的多个远程部署设备上进行管理的推荐方法是什么?

1 个答案:

答案 0 :(得分:1)

一种解决方法是使用 sudo docker images prune -a ,它会删除所有没有任何正在运行或已保存容器引用它们的图像。

使用以下命令删除未使用的图像。

$ env:DOCKER_HOST =“ npipe:////./pipe/iotedge_moby_engine”

docker image prune -a